Cowgirl Tennis Finishes Strong at Indoor Championships
February 08, 2015 | Cowgirl Tennis
CHARLOTTESVILLE, Va. – The No. 16 Oklahoma State women's tennis team took down No. 11 Vanderbilt in its final match of the ITA Team Indoor Championships on Sunday.
"I am so proud of our girls for the way they responded today,” coach Chris Young said. “We played two great teams in the first two rounds, and today was another great opponent in Vandy, but from the start we came out with more energy and just grinded out a win. This team showed a lot of perseverance today and that makes me proud and excited for the rest of the season."
The Cowgirls got off to a great start, winning an exciting doubles point. The No. 5 tandem of Viktoriya Lushkova and Kelsey Laurente dominated on court one, handing the No. 32 Colton/Campbell team its first doubles loss of the season, 6-1.
On court two, Katarina Adamovic and Vladica Babic defeated Vandy's Antal/Casares pair, 6-3, to pick up the doubles point for the Cowgirls.
Carla Tur Mari and Maria Alvarez had match point on court three when doubles play ended.
In singles, sophomore Tur Mari added to the Cowgirl lead, handily defeating No. 77 Marie Casares at the No. 4 spot, 6-3, 6-1. It was her first win over a ranked opponent this spring.
Vanderbilt fought back, grabbing wins on courts three and four to tie the team score, 2-2.
The remaining three matches were tight and all went to a third set. On court one, All-American Viktoriya Lushkova dropped a tough first set, 6-4, to No. 15 Sydney Campbell. The sophomore overcame, producing huge wins in the second and third sets, 6-2, 6-2.
“It was great to see Viki step up and play her style of tennis today,” Young said. “The match was played at an extremely high level, and she dictated the play in final two sets.”
Junior Maria Alvarez clinched the match just in time at the No. 6 spot, defeating Ashleigh Antal in three sets. Alvarez lost her first set, 6-3, but pushed back in the next set, winning 6-1. The third set was taken to a tiebreaker, where Alvarez stepped up delivering a 7-1 win.
“Maria is someone I completely trust and want on the court when the match is on the line,” Young said. “She has come through twice already this year and her toughness is such an important part of this team.”
Play on court two was not finished as Kelsey Laurente took on Courtney Colton.
